Here's to the mouse who started it all!

Oh, boy! It's been nearly 100 years since Mickey Mouse made his debut in Steamboat Willie. The short film, which was the first cartoon with synchronized sound, premiered Nov. 18, 1928, marking the beloved mouse's official birthday.

While Mickey wasn't Walt Disney's first cartoon character—that was Oswald the Lucky Rabbit—he is, in the words of the late innovator, the one who "started" it all.

“He popped out of my mind onto a drawing pad 20 years ago on a train ride from Manhattan to Hollywood at a time when the business fortunes of my brother Roy and myself were at lowest ebb, and disaster seemed right around the corner,” the legendary animator wrote in a 1948 essay titled “What Mickey Means to Me.

In honor of Mickey's birthday, we're taking a look at the man behind the mouse with the best Walt Disney quotes.

Walt Disney quotes

1. "All our dreams can come true, if we have the courage to pursue them."

2. "It's kind of fun to do the impossible."

3. "When you’re curious, you find lots of interesting things to do."

4. “Laughter is timeless, imagination has no age, dreams are forever.”

5. "Togetherness, for me, means teamwork.”

6. “By nature I’m an experimenter. To this day, I don’t believe in sequels. I can’t follow popular cycles. I have to move on to new things. So with the success of Mickey, I was determined to diversify.”

7. “The way to get started is to quit talking and begin doing.”

8. “A man should never neglect his family for business.”

9. “If you can dream it, you can do it.”

10. “The more you like yourself, the less you are like anyone else, which makes you unique.”

11. “When you believe in a thing, believe in it all the way, implicitly and unquestionable.”

12. “We keep moving forward, opening new doors, and doing new things, because we’re curious and curiosity keeps leading us down new paths.”

13. “Laughter is America’s most important export.”

14. “Our greatest natural resource is the minds of our children.”

15. “First, think. Second, believe. Third, dream. And finally, dare.”

16. "You reach a point where you don’t work for money.”

17. “I only hope that we never lose sight of one thing—that it was all started by a mouse.”

18. “I dream, I test my dreams against my beliefs, I dare to take risks, and I execute my vision to make those dreams come true.”

19. “I believe in being a motivator.”

20. “We share, to a large extent, one another’s fate. We help create those circumstances which favor or challenge us in meeting our objectives and realizing our dreams.”

21. “Disneyland will never be completed. It will continue to grow as long as there is imagination left in the world.”

22. “I love Mickey Mouse more than any woman I have ever known.”

23. “The difference between winning and losing is most often not quitting.”

24. “Everyone needs deadlines. Even the beavers. They loaf around all summer, but when they are faced with the winter deadline, they work like fury. If we didn’t have deadlines, we’d stagnate.”

25. “Whatever you do, do it well.”

26. "When people laugh at Mickey Mouse it’s because he’s so human; and that is the secret of his popularity.”

27. “Never get bored or cynical. Yesterday is a thing of the past.”

28. “That’s the real trouble with the world, too many people grow up. They forget.”

29. “Everyone falls down. Getting back up is how you learn how to walk.”

30. "Adults are only kids grown up."

31. “It’s a mistake not to give people a chance to learn to depend on themselves while they are young.”

32. “We allow no geniuses around our Studio.”

33. “I resent the limitations of my own imagination.”

34. “In bad times and in good, I’ve never lost my sense of zest for life.”

35. “Most of my life I have done what I wanted to do. I have had fun on the job.”

36. “People often ask me if I know the secret of success and if I could tell others how to make their dreams come true. My answer is, you do it by working.”

37. “I do not like to repeat successes, I like to go on to other things.”

38. “I have been up against tough competition all my life. I wouldn’t know how to get along without it.”

39. “That’s what we storytellers do. We restore order with imagination. We instill hope again and again and again.”

40. “Happiness is a state of mind. It’s just according to the way you look at things.”

41. “The greatest moments in life are not concerned with selfish achievements but rather with the things we do for the people we love and esteem, and whose respect we need.”

42. “Get a good idea, and stay with it. Dog it, and work at it until it’s done, and done right.”

43. “To the youngsters of today, I say believe in the future, the world is getting better; there still is plenty of opportunity.”

44. "Why do we have to grow up? I know more adults who have the children’s approach to life...They are not afraid to be delighted with simple pleasures, and they have a degree of contentment with what life has brought—sometimes it isn’t much, either.”

45. “Every child is born blessed with a vivid imagination.”

46. “I think it’s important to have a good hard failure when you’re young. I learned a lot out of that. Because it makes you kind of aware of what can happen to you.”

47. “I do not make films primarily for children. I make them for the child in all of us, whether we be six or sixty.”

48. “Fantasy, if it’s really convincing, can’t become dated, for the simple reason that it represents a flight into a dimension that lies beyond the reach of time.”

49. “I don’t want the public to see the world they live in while they’re in the Park. I want them to feel they’re in another world.”

50. “The important thing is the family.”

51. “To all who come to this happy place: Welcome. Disneyland is your land. Here age relives fond memories of the past—and here youth may savor the challenge and promise of the future. Disneyland is dedicated to the ideals, the dreams and the hard facts that have created America—with the hope that it will be a source of joy and inspiration to all the world.”

52. "There is more treasure in books than in all the pirates’ loot on Treasure Island and at the bottom of the Spanish Main…and best of all, you can enjoy these riches every day of your life.”

53. “I love the nostalgic myself. I hope we never lose some of the things of the past.”

54. “Why worry? If you’ve done the very best you can, worrying won’t make it any better. I worry about many things, but not about water over the dam.”

55. “The life and ventures of Mickey Mouse have been closely bound up with my own personal and professional life. . . He still speaks for me and I still speak for him.”
